+/*
|
|
|
+ * +===========================================================================
|
|
|
+ * | 00-1024 | USB packet
|
|
|
+ * +===========================================================================
|
|
|
+ * | 00- 03 | sequence number of first sample in that USB packet
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 04- 15 | garbage
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 16- 175 | sam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 176- 179 | control bits for previous sam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 180- 339 | sam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 340- 343 | control bits for previous sam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 344- 503 | sam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 504- 507 | control bits for previous sam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 508- 667 | sam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 668- 671 | control bits for previous sam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 672- 831 | sam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 832- 835 | control bits for previous sam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 836- 995 | sam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 996- 999 | control bits for previous samples
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 * | 1000-1024 | garbage
|
|
|
+ * +---------------------------------------------------------------------------
|
|
|
+ *
|
|
|
+ * Bytes 4 - 7 could have some meaning?
|
|
|
+ *
|
|
|
+ * Control bits for previous samples is 32-bit field, containing 16 x 2-bit
|
|
|
+ * numbers. This results one 2-bit number for 8 samples. It is likely used for
|
|
|
+ * for bit shifting sample by given bits, increasing actual sampling resolution.
|
|
|
+ * Number 2 (0b10) was never seen.
|
|
|
+ *
|
|
|
+ * 6 * 16 * 2 * 4 = 768 samples. 768 * 4 = 3072 bytes
|
|
|
+ */
